2014-07-01 142 views
2

當啓動Appium,我得到以下錯誤:當啓動Appium,我得到以下錯誤:「ERROR:main.js:錯誤:無法識別參數

ERROR: main.js: error: Unrecognized arguments: SDK\adt-bundle-windows-x86_64-20140321\sdk\build-tools\android-4.4.2\LiftMaster_stg3_06132014.apk.

了Android上運行WINDOWNS 7機4.4已連接,並且已經安裝了node.js.Appium,請幫助!

+0

你可以發佈'main.js'代碼... – War10ck

+0

請原諒我的無知,但我該如何發佈main.js代碼? – user3794391

回答

1

由於(如果您從命令行啓動Appium),您沒有將參數--app傳遞給您的路徑.apk文件。

$ appium path\to\app.apk 
appium: error: Unrecognized arguments: path\to\app.apk. 

與工作:

$ appium --app path\to\app.apk 
info: Welcome to Appium v1.1.0 (REV e433bbc31511f199287db7724e1ce692bcb32117) 
info: Appium REST http interface listener started on 0.0.0.0:4723 
info: socket.io started 
info: Non-default server args: {"app":"path\to\app.apk"} 
0

我遇到了同樣的問題。還有,如果沒有錯誤main.js

error: Unrecognized arguments.

  1. Appium - 基本設置 - 記錄可以啓動appium(UI),確保「相當記錄」的解決方案沒有被選中。
  2. 您可以在桌面(或其他目錄)上設置並保存日誌。

然後嘗試再次啓動並運行您的appium腳本。在我的筆記本電腦中,它可以正常工作。

2

我通過在(應用程序路徑)周圍添加引號來解決它,因爲我的Windows用戶名中有一個空格

1

我得到這個錯誤,因爲我的apk放在文件夾中,空間爲。刪除空間工作對我來說@@

相關問題